Ingredients
For the salad:
- 5 cups fresh kale, chopped
- 3 cups romaine, torn
- 1 (14-ounce) package coleslaw mix
- 1 medium fennel bulb, thinly sliced
- 1 cup fresh broccoli, chopped
- 1/2 cup red cabbage, shredded
- 1 cup feta cheese, crumbled
- 1/4 cup sesame seeds, toasted
- fresh strawberries, optional, sliced, for topping
For the dressing:
- 1/3 cup extra-virgin olive oil
- 3 tablespoons sesame oil
- 2 tablespoons honey
- 2 tablespoons cider vinegar
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- 1/3 cup strawberries, puréed

Directions
Step 1 –Combine the kale and the romaine.
Step 2 –Add the coleslaw mix, the fennel, the broccoli, and the red cabbage.
Step 3 –Sprinkle in the feta cheese and the sesame seeds and toss to combine.
Step 4 –In a separate bowl, stir together the olive oil and the sesame oil.
Step 5 –Whisk the honey, the vinegar, and the lemon juice into the oil mixture.
Step 6 –Add the puréed strawberries into the dressing mixture and whisk to combine.
Step 7 –Dress the salad just before serving, and top with the sliced strawberries.
Step 8 –Serve.
